Pointcarre: What types of textiles can I design with Pointcarre?

Pointcarre supports design for home and interiors, including carpets and rugs, bed and bath linens, curtains and sheers, upholstery fabrics. It offers specialized tools for repeat pattern generation, visualization, and manufacturing integration.

Pointcarre: What textile products are included in Pointcarre?

Pointcarre includes software for Jacquard (weaving), Dobby (dobby weave), Printing (print design), Tufting (carpet tufting), and Knitting (knit design), plus Mapping tools and LoomNet connectivity.
